You perform an experiment in which nuclear material (chromatin) is isolated from what appears to be martian cells. You briefly digest with micrococcal nuclease. When the chromatin proteins are removed and the resulting purified DNA is analyzed by gel elecrophoresis, you observe a series of DNA fragments that are multiples of 410 base pairs in length (i. e., 410 bp, 820 bp, 1230 bp, 1640 bp, and so forth). What can you conclude about the organization of DNA and protein in the Martian sample
